Ingredients You’ll Need
For the Donut Dough
- 2¼ teaspoons active dry yeast (1 packet)
- ¼ cup warm water (110°F)
- ¾ cup warm milk 🥛
- ¼ cup granulated sugar
- ¼ cup unsalted butter, melted 🧈
- 1 large egg 🥚
- ½ teaspoon salt
- 3 to 3½ cups all-purpose flour
For Frying
- Vegetable oil
For the Classic Glaze
- 2 cups powdered sugar
- ¼ cup whole milk
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
- 2 tablespoons melted butter

Step-by-Step Instructions
Step 1: Activate the Yeast
In a bowl, combine:
- Warm water
- Yeast
Let sit for 5–10 minutes until foamy.
Step 2: Make the Dough
Add:
- Warm milk
- Sugar
- Melted butter
- Egg
- Salt
Mix well.
Gradually add flour until a soft dough forms.
Step 3: Knead the Dough
Transfer dough to a lightly floured surface.
Knead for:
8–10 minutes
until smooth and elastic.
Step 4: First Rise
Place dough in a greased bowl.
Cover and let rise for:
1–1½ hours
or until doubled in size.
Step 5: Roll and Cut
Roll dough to about:
½-inch thickness
Use a donut cutter or two round cutters.
Cut out donuts and donut holes.
Step 6: Second Rise
Place cut donuts on parchment paper.
Cover lightly.
Allow to rise for:
30–45 minutes
until puffy.
Step 7: Heat the Oil
Heat oil to:
350°F (175°C)
Maintain temperature carefully.
Step 8: Fry the Donuts
Fry donuts in batches.
Cook:
- 1 minute per side
until golden brown.
Remove and drain briefly on paper towels.
How to Make the Glaze
In a bowl, whisk together:
- Powdered sugar
- Milk
- Vanilla
- Melted butter
Mix until smooth and glossy.
Glazing the Donuts
While donuts are still slightly warm:
Dip each donut into the glaze.
Place on a wire rack.
Allow excess glaze to drip off.
Let the glaze set for 10–15 minutes.
Tips for Perfect Homemade Krispy Kremes
Use Fresh Yeast
Ensures a proper rise.
Don’t Add Too Much Flour
The dough should remain soft.
Maintain Oil Temperature
Too hot burns the outside.
Too cool makes donuts greasy.
Glaze While Warm
Creates the classic melt-in-your-mouth finish.
Avoid Overcrowding the Oil
This keeps frying temperatures consistent.

Storage Instructions
Room Temperature
Store in an airtight container for up to 2 days.
Refrigerator
Store for up to 5 days.
Warm slightly before serving.
Freezer
Freeze unglazed donuts for up to 2 months.
Thaw and glaze before serving.

Frequently Asked Questions
Are Krispy Kreme donuts yeast-raised?
Yes. Their signature texture comes from yeast dough.
Can I bake these instead of frying?
Yes, but they won’t have the same classic texture.
Why are my donuts dense?
Usually from too much flour or insufficient rising time.
Can I use instant yeast?
Absolutely. Reduce activation time as directed on the package.
How do I keep donuts soft?
Store in an airtight container and enjoy within 1–2 days.

Homemade Krispy Kremes 🍩✨ | Soft, Fluffy & Melt-in-Your-Mouth Glazed Donuts
Ingredients
For the Donuts:
- 2 1/4 tsp active dry yeast (1 packet)
- 1/4 cup warm water (110°F/45°C)
- 3/4 cup warm whole milk
- 1/4 cup granulated sugar
- 1 large egg
- 1/4 cup unsalted butter, melted
- 3 cups all-purpose flour
- 1/2 tsp salt
- Vegetable oil, for frying
For the Glaze:
- 2 cups powdered sugar
- 1/4 cup whole milk
- 1 tsp vanilla extract
Instructions
- In a large bowl, dissolve yeast in warm water and let stand for 5 minutes until foamy.
- Add warm milk, sugar, egg, and melted butter. Mix well.
- Stir in flour and salt until a soft dough forms.
- Knead the dough for 6–8 minutes until smooth and elastic.
- Place dough in a lightly greased bowl, cover, and let rise for 1–1½ hours or until doubled in size.
- Roll dough out to about 1/2-inch thickness on a lightly floured surface.
- Cut out donut shapes using a donut cutter or two round cutters.
- Place on parchment-lined trays, cover lightly, and let rise for 30–45 minutes.
- Heat oil to 350°F (175°C).
- Fry donuts in batches for 1–2 minutes per side until golden brown.
- Transfer to a wire rack set over a baking sheet.
- Whisk together powdered sugar, milk, and vanilla until smooth.
- Dip warm donuts into the glaze and place back on the rack to set.
